Truss Bridges: Timeless Structures of Strength and Efficiency


Truss bridges stand as a cornerstone of civil engineering, celebrated for their exceptional strength, efficiency, and adaptability across centuries. Defined by their rigid framework of interconnected triangular units—known as trusses—these bridges distribute weight evenly across the structure, making them ideal for spanning both short and long distances while using materials economically. This innovative design has made truss bridges a popular choice for everything from rural footbridges to major highway crossings.


At the heart of a truss bridge’s functionality is the triangular truss system. Unlike solid beams that bear weight through their entire structure, trusses use straight steel, wood, or concrete members (called chords, verticals, and diagonals) joined at nodes. The triangular shape is key: it resists bending and spreading under load, transferring forces like tension and compression to the bridge’s supports (piers or abutments) rather than concentrating stress on single points. This design not only maximizes strength but also minimizes material use—truss bridges are often lighter than solid-beam bridges of the same span, reducing construction costs and environmental impact.


Truss bridges come in various types, each tailored to specific needs. The simple Warren truss, with its repeating equilateral triangles, is common for pedestrian and light-vehicle bridges. The Pratt truss, featuring vertical compression members and diagonal tension members, excels at supporting heavy loads, making it a top choice for railroad bridges. The Howe truss, with reversed diagonal and vertical roles, was historically popular for wooden bridges in rural areas. Modern truss bridges often use steel, as it offers superior durability and can span longer distances—some steel truss bridges stretch over 1,000 meters, connecting cities and crossing large rivers.

Beyond functionality, truss bridges often hold cultural significance. Many historic truss bridges, like the iconic Brooklyn Bridge (a hybrid suspension-truss design), are landmarks that reflect the engineering ingenuity of their era. Today, they remain relevant: in urban areas, they support busy highways; in remote regions, they provide reliable access to communities; and in industrial settings, they carry heavy machinery.


With their blend of timeless design and practicality, truss bridges continue to prove their worth. They demonstrate how smart structural engineering can create long-lasting, cost-effective solutions that stand strong against the test of time and use.

CB200 Truss Press Limited Table
NO. Internal Force Structure Form
Not Reinforced Model Reinforced Model
SS DS TS QS SSR DSR TSR QSR
200 Standard Truss Moment(kN.m) 1034.3 2027.2 2978.8 3930.3 2165.4 4244.2 6236.4 8228.6
200 Standard Truss Shear (kN) 222.1 435.3 639.6 843.9 222.1 435.3 639.6 843.9
201 High Bending Truss Moment(kN.m) 1593.2 3122.8 4585.5 6054.3 3335.8 6538.2 9607.1 12676.1
202 High Bending Truss Shear(kN) 348 696 1044 1392 348 696 1044 1392
203 Shear Force of Super High Shear Truss(kN) 509.8 999.2 1468.2 1937.2 509.8 999.2 1468.2 1937.2
CB200 Table of Geometric Characteristics of Truss Bridge(Half Bridge)
Structure Geometric Characteristics
Geometric Characteristics Chord Area(cm2) Section Properties(cm3) Moment of Inertia(cm4)
ss SS 25.48 5437 580174
SSR 50.96 10875 1160348
DS DS 50.96 10875 1160348
DSR1 76.44 16312 1740522
DSR2 101.92 21750 2320696
TS TS 76.44 16312 1740522
TSR2 127.4 27185 2900870
TSR3 152.88 32625 3481044
QS QS 101.92 21750 2320696
QSR3 178.36 38059 4061218
QSR4 203.84 43500 4641392
